static void Dmod_Print_Octal( char** Buffer, size_t* Pos, size_t Size, uint32_t Value, int* Count )
{
char Temp[12]; // Enough for 11 octal digits (32-bit)
int i = 0;

// Convert to octal string (reversed)
do
{
Temp[i++] = '0' + (Value & 0x7);
Value >>= 3;
} while( Value > 0 );

// Print in correct order
while( i > 0 )
{
Dmod_Print_Char( Buffer, Pos, Size, Temp[--i], Count );
}
}

static void Dmod_Print_Octal64( char** Buffer, size_t* Pos, size_t Size, uint64_t Value, int* Count )
{
char Temp[23]; // Enough for 22 octal digits (64-bit)
int i = 0;

// Convert to octal string (reversed)
do
{
Temp[i++] = '0' + (Value & 0x7);
Value >>= 3;
} while( Value > 0 );

// Print in correct order
while( i > 0 )
{
Dmod_Print_Char( Buffer, Pos, Size, Temp[--i], Count );
}
}
